What is GRP Grating?

GRP grating is a composite material made from fiberglass layers embedded in resin, creating a strong and durable structure. Unlike traditional steel grating, GRP grating doesn’t rust or corrode, making it ideal for hostile environments such as chemical plants, marine applications, and outdoor settings exposed to harsh weather.

Manufactured through two primary processes—molding and pultrusion—GRP grating offers variations in design and application. Molding is often used for standard, customizable shapes, while pultrusion produces continuous lengths of grating that can be customized for specific applications, offering advantages in construction speed and flexibility.

Benefits of GRP Grating

The benefits of using GRP grating are vast, including:

  • Corrosion Resistance: GRP does not rust or degrade in watery and chemical environments, extending its lifespan significantly compared to metal grating.
  • Lightweight: GRP grating is significantly lighter than steel, making it easier to transport and install, leading to reduced labor costs.
  • Slip Resistance: Many GRP grating options come with a textured surface, providing superior traction and reducing the risk of slips and falls.
  • Customizability: GRP grating can be designed in various colors and sizes to meet specific project requirements, enhancing aesthetic appeal.
  • Electrical Insulation: GRP serves as an effective insulator, beneficial in electric hazard areas.

Common Applications of GRP Grating

GRP grating finds applications across a vast array of sectors:

  • Chemical Processing: Ideal for environments involving aggressive chemicals, GRP grating ensures safety and durability.
  • Marine Applications: Resilient against saltwater and extreme weather, it’s often used in docks and offshore platforms.
  • Food and Beverage Industry: Non-corrosive and easy to sanitize, making it suitable for processing areas.
  • Construction: Used extensively in walkways, phase segregation, and trench covers due to its lightweight and strong profile.
  • Wastewater Treatment: GRP grating endures harsh conditions while maintaining structural integrity.

Installation of GRP Grating

Installing GRP grating is a straightforward process, but proper preparation and following appropriate steps can ensure a smooth installation. Familiarizing yourself with the materials and methods involved will help maximize the benefits of GRP grating.

Preparation for Installation

Before starting the installation, consider the following preparation steps:

  • Site Assessment: Evaluate the installation site conditions and prepare the surface for grating lay-down.
  • Measurement: Accurately measure the area to cut GRP grating to size before installation.
  • Review Specifications: Check that the chosen grating meets loading requirements and other specific project needs.
  • Gather Tools: Ensure all necessary tools, such as cutting tools, safety gear, and fixing components, are available.
  • Check Compatibility: Verify that the grating type matches any existing equipment or surfaces.

Step-by-Step Installation Guide

Follow these steps for effective installation of GRP grating:

  1. Cutting the Grating: Using a power saw or jigsaw, cut the grating to the exact dimensions required.
  2. Positioning Grating: Carefully place the grating panels into position, aligning them correctly.
  3. Fixing Grating: Use appropriate fasteners or clips to secure the grating panels in place.
  4. Sealing Edges: Apply sealant as needed around the edges for enhanced durability, especially in corrosive environments.

Maintenance of GRP Grating Systems

Maintaining GRP grating systems is crucial for ensuring longevity and optimal performance. Regular maintenance minimizes the risk of early degradation and enhances safety in work environments.

Routine Cleaning and Care

Implementing a routine cleaning schedule is vital. Here are some best practices:

  • Regular Inspections: Check for signs of wear or damage routinely to catch issues early.
  • Cleaning: Use gentle cleaning methods, such as water and mild detergent, to remove debris and contaminants.
  • Surface Checks: Ensure the surface remains slip-resistant by inspecting for damage or wear.
  • Avoid Harsh Chemicals: Refrain from using abrasive cleaners as they can damage the grating surface.
  • Document Maintenance: Keep a log of inspection and cleaning schedules for reference.

Identifying and Resolving Issues

Promptly addressing any issues that arise is essential. Common problems include:

  • Bending or Warping: Regularly check for and address any visible bending; ensure proper support is maintained.
  • Cracking: If cracks appear, they should be assessed and repaired as needed to avoid further damage.
  • Loose Fasteners: Periodically check fasteners and re-tighten as necessary to ensure structural integrity.
  • Surface Wear: Address any signs of wear early to prevent slips and other safety hazards.
  • Replacement Parts: Keep spare parts handy for quicker repairs when necessary.

Extending the Lifespan of Your Grating

To extend the lifespan of GRP grating systems, consider the following proactive measures:

  • Proper Installation: Ensure that initial installation is done correctly following manufacturer guidelines.
  • Avoid Overloading: Do not exceed the load capacity specified for the grating to avert failure.
  • Regular Upkeep: Engage in routine maintenance as discussed, including cleaning and inspections.
  • Control Environmental Factors: Where possible, shield gratings from extreme conditions such as intense UV exposure or chemical spills.
  • Educate Users: Train personnel on the right use and care of grating systems, emphasizing the importance of maintaining integrity.
